We invite referrals of individuals who present with common mental health problems (e.g. depression, anxiety, relationship issues, loss, and bereavement) and distress or adjustment issues around long-term health conditions, diabetes and COPD. We offer a range of psychological interventions to those aged 18* and above who live in Newham or are registered with a Newham GP.

 

Referral criteria

We accept referrals for those aged over 18 and over only. We do not have an upper age limit and we actively encourage referrals for those over 65’s. However, older adults with age-related issues (e.g. dementia) should be referred to Mental Health Care for Older People.

Patients in Crisis

Newham Talking Therapies are not a crisis service.  For a patient who is in crisis, a risk to self or others, access details of the emergency help.

Individuals with severe, enduring and complex mental health problems (e.g. psychosis, personality disorders, bipolar, risks to self and others) should be referred to:

Community Integrated Mental Health Service
